Q3: Page 4, lines 137, 138: “…..At this stage, the decision-maker sets the initial weight for multi-objectives according to their experience,…..” Can you please provide some more details about the “initial weight” ? Are weights subjective ? To what extent ?

A3: The initial weight is usually determined by trade-off analyses, which is a mixture of quantitative and qualitative analysis. The subjective part is that the decision makers choose the tool and set the parameters for trade-off analyses, which reflects their preferences. We have changed the original expression and add more details for the initial weight determination.
